mate head south along the
mate head south along the beach from hillarys marina and you will see a south cardinal marker off trigg point head out to that and there is lumpes all around, south west off the marker 0.5nm is where to start looking

You wont have any trouble
You wont have any trouble getting sambos down there, i commercially crayfish down there and the sambos eat our old cray bait off the surface, berley is the key, look for pro pots if they are there.
